Two examples of red tide are the Florida red tide caused by Karenia brevis algae and the California red tide caused by Lingulodinium polyedrum algae. Both of these algae produce toxins that can harm marine life and humans.

Avoiding red tide involves staying away from affected areas, abstaining from eating contaminated seafood, and being mindful of any respiratory issues that may arise from exposure to red tide toxins. Monitoring local advisories and being cautious of discolored water or dead fish can help prevent encountering red tide.
